What affects the price

When you are looking at the price of a new water heater, a few main things shift the final number. The type of unit you choose—whether it is a tank model or a tankless system—is the biggest factor. You also have to consider the fuel source, like gas or electric, and the physical space where the heater sits. If your home needs new venting, updated piping, or a different hookup to meet current safety codes, that adds labor time to the project.

How long do hot water heaters typically last in Elk Grove?

In Elk Grove, traditional tank water heaters typically last between 8 to 12 years. Tankless water heaters, with proper care, can often extend their lifespan to 20 years or more. The local water quality and how frequently you use hot water in your Elk Grove home can impact these estimates. Regular professional maintenance is key.

What is the most efficient type of water heater for Elk Grove homes?

For Elk Grove homes seeking peak efficiency, tankless water heaters are a popular choice because they heat water only when needed, conserving energy. Heat pump water heaters also offer significant energy savings and are a good option for many households. The best fit depends on your specific hot water usage and home setup.

What are signs I need a new water heater in Elk Grove?

Common indicators that your Elk Grove water heater needs replacement include a noticeable decrease in hot water supply, unusual noises like rumbling or banging, visible rust on the tank, or water leaks. If your unit is over a decade old and experiencing these issues, it's wise to consider a new installation.

What is the most common problem with a hot water heater?

Sediment buildup is a frequent culprit for hot water heater issues, leading to reduced efficiency and noise. Other common problems involve thermostat failures, issues with the heating elements, and minor leaks. Many of these can be resolved with timely professional attention.
